ICCA Case Study : Imago Venues

Loughborough-based academic venue gets a good analysis
he International Conference of Conversations Analysis ( ICCA ) is a quadrennial conference organised in partnership with the International Society for Conversation Analysis . Recently , it has been held in Copenhagen , Helsinki , Manheim and Los Angeles . The event sees experts in linguistics and sociology come together to discuss the language we use and the way we interact . For 2018 , the organisers wanted an accessible event in terms of location due to the association ’ s increasingly global audience . They needed a range of quality accommodation , facilities capable of hosting over 550 delegates for the plenary , plus breakout spaces for up to 12 concurrent sessions . It was also essential the conference take place in an academic venue with a reputation as a centre of excellence in the field of Conversation Analysis . With professor Paul Drew acting as ambassador and lead organiser , Loughborough University and its Imago Venues portfolio was the perfect solution . Prof Drew ’ s involvement meant that someone with a huge amount of passion and subject knowledge was taking the reins for an event incorporating more than 500 sessions across six days . To support him through the logistical elements of the event , Imago Venues also provided comprehensive event management services . They supported Drew throughout the entire event journey – from planning and logistics through to execution and event finances . Most importantly , however , the Imago Venues team brought a creative approach that saw previously formal dinners turned into networking BBQs , creative theming and an app that was accessed more than 20,000 times during the event .
